Concerning the activity "High performance beam simulation tools”:
This work concerns in particular a collaboration with A. Oeftiger from GSI, in which we work on the benchmarking and development of simulation tools for high intensity effects such as space charge. In this framework, we have been working on 
a) the development of space charge modules directly for Sixtracklib (tracking tool) and for a combination of PyHEADTAIL (collective effects simulations) with Sixtracklib, 
b) optimizing the simulation speed for high-performance computing architectures 
c) a study of space charge induced resonances in the SIS100

Future plans include to establish a detailed PIC model of the SPS, to develop advanced indirect space charge models and possibly to perform a joint measurement campaign of long-term space charge effects.
